HBI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

450 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Hanesbrands (HBI)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$1.32B — down 15% from $1.55B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 84 funds closed out of HBI and 46 opened new positions — a net loss of 38 holders — while 178 trimmed existing stakes and 128 added.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$41.9M. The largest seller was Marshall Wace, cutting an estimated $21.8M.
